Quick resume
Melatonin is a rhythm game about dreams and reality merging together. It uses animations and sound cues to keep you on beat without any intimidating overlays or interfaces. Harmonize through a variety of dreamy levels containing surprising challenges, hand-drawn art, and vibrant music.

Pros
- Relaxing and immersive atmosphere
- Tight and satisfying rhythm gameplay
- Beautiful pastel art style and animations
- Accessible with multiple difficulty and assist options
- Level editor and workshop support for custom content
Cons
- Short main game length
- Strict timing windows can be frustrating
- Some audio cues lack clarity
- Limited narrative and story depth
- Calibration range could be improved
